Mesothelioma, a cancer, develops on the linings of several internal organs including the chest cavity lining, the lining of the heart and the abdomen, as well as the lung. Asbestos patients may have been exposed to asbestos at their workplace at home, or in military service. The signs of mesothelioma generally do not appear until 20 to 50 years after exposure.

Asbestos victims can file a selah mesothelioma law firm lawsuit against the companies that manufacture asbestos-containing products responsible for their exposure. These companies knew asbestos was dangerous but used it for profit. These asbestos companies can be sued by victims of mesothelioma to receive millions in compensation.

Compensation in mesothelioma cases can be a result of compensatory damages, such as past and future medical expenses as well as lost wages physical pain, emotional distress, and more. Asbestos victims may also be eligible for compensation through asbestos trusts. These trusts are funded by bankruptcy trusts, and currently hold assets worth more than $30 billion.

The best mesothelioma lawyers will provide an evaluation for free of your case. They also offer an arrangement for a contingency fee which means that the client will not be charged for legal services unless they win compensation. National firms like Weitz & Luxenberg, Simmons Hanly Conroy and others have a proven track record of obtaining significant settlements on behalf of clients.

Mesothelioma victims should consult with an attorney for mesothelioma as soon as they can to ensure that they submit an action within the timeframe of limitations. This is four years from the date of diagnosis or two years from the death of a loved ones in Florida. The filing of a lawsuit after the statute of limitations has expired could result in the court's refusal of the case.
